Mickey’s
Not-So-Scary Halloween Party Tickets
Prices vary per date and will be available for purchase May 5th for guests staying at select Walt Disney world Resort hotels, Walt Disney world Swan & Dolphin and Shades of Green.
Tickets will be available for purchase starting May 12th
for all oter guests. Party dates often sell out, so our best tip is to plan
early and purchase tickets in advance for your desired party date.
Discounts on Party Tickets are available for Annual
Passholders and Disney Vacation Club Members.
*Planning Tip: Mickey’s Not-So-Scary guests can enter
Magic Kingdom as early as 4:00pm before the party kicks off at 7:00 pm this
means guests have up to 8 hours to celebrate all across the park.
For some of us, our Halloween dreams include a bag
overflowing with candy. Mickey’s Not-So-Scary Halloween Party is one of the
best trick-or-treat destinations, with over a dozen opportunities to collect
candy throughout the park, marked on your party map/ and this year, guests can
expect even more fun than ever before with some familiar (and fiendish) faces surprising
guests along the trails.
At each stop, cast members give out handfuls of Mars Wrigley
favorites like M&Ms, Snickers and Starburst. And no worries if you forgot
your pumpkin bucket at home: Each guest will receive a complimentary treat bag
for candy collection (that includes adults).
Trick-or-treaters do not have to be in costume to collect
candy. Guests are encouraged to dress up in creative Halloween costumes. Be
sure to follow the official costume guidelines.
Exclusive
Character Greetings
Guests can meet Sally and Jack Skellington at Mickey’s
not so Scary Halloween Party at one of the many character stops that feature
exclusive meet-and greet opportunities. At town Square Theater, Mickey and
Minnie will greet guests together in their Halloween costumes. Pooh will be in
his bumblebee costume, and you may spot festive royal couples ready to say
hello, like ariel and Eric and Aladdin and Jasmine.

Hocus Pocus Villain Spelltacular
It’s been three hundred years, right down to the day … or
it seems that long since we’ve seen the Sanderson Sisters take the stage. This fan-favorite
show is both hilarious and bone-chilling as Winifred, Sarah, and Mary try their
haphazard best to cast a spell.
It turns out that they need a little help from their
friends, who happen to be some of the most nefarious Disney Villains, including
the likes of Hades, Cruella De Vil, Jafar, Dr. Facilier, and The Evil Queen.
Guests will help add ingredients to the cauldron with lots of clapping and
singing along.
